Kontekst: Toshiba Satellite L75D-A7280 64bit, Windows 10 Home 64bit
Jak długo powinienem oczekiwać, że 2015 r. Sam się naprawi? Minęło ponad 8 godzin i przez większą część czasu nie wykroczyliśmy poza „Microsoft Build Tools 14.0 (x86)”.
Kusi mnie, aby usunąć drzewo folderów Visual Studio, uruchomić CCleaner w rejestrze, aby przynajmniej częściowo wyczyścić bałagan, a następnie zainstalować od zera.
UWAGA
Zabicie naprawy będzie wymagać ponownego uruchomienia komputera. Jeśli ktoś próbuje odinstalować natychmiast po zabitej naprawie, pojawia się komunikat o trwającej instalacji. Ponowne uruchomienie wydaje się być jedyną rzeczą, aby usunąć wszelkie flagi pozostawione przez proces naprawy.
PÓŹNIEJ, ŻE TEN SAM DZIEŃ
Zabiłem to. Zrestartowano. Znaleziono vs_community.exe. Wprowadzono polecenie vs_community.exe /uninstall /force
. Siedzi i nie robi wiele od kilku godzin poza „Stosowanie: Narzędzia diagnostyczne Microsoft Visual Studio 2015 - x86”. Te pięć małych kropek wchodzi, łączy się i odlatuje w kółko. I znowu. I znowu. ...
PARA DNI PÓŹNIEJ
Natknąłem się na sposób przyspieszenia dezinstalacji. Po ponownym uruchomieniu program Visual Studio zapamiętuje miejsce, w którym byłeś w trakcie odinstalowywania, i ponownie rozpoczyna pracę od miejsca, w którym przerwałeś, ale jedna podzadanie odinstalowania jest kontynuowane.
PO TYM
Dzisiaj miałem zamiar zrestartować komputer, a potem go anulować. Nagle dezinstalacja zaczęła działać szybko. Chwilę później znów się zatrzymał. Więc ponownie poszedłem zrestartować komputer, a potem go anulowałem. Ponownie odinstalowanie przyspieszyło i przeszło kolejne podzadania. Teraz niebieski pasek postępu „Nakładanie” to 3/4, zamiast siedzieć przez kilka dni w 1/10.
WIELE MIESIĘCY PÓŹNIEJ
Odinstalowanie VS2015 zajmuje również godziny, a może dni. Usuwam go przed instalacją VS2017. Rozpocząłem ten proces może 36 godzin temu i jeszcze się nie skończył.
źródło
Odpowiedzi:
Konfiguracja rzeczywiście stwarza problem. Próbowałem odinstalować + naprawić, wszystkie zachowują się tak samo. Moje środowisko to Win 10 x64. Więc dopóki nie pojawi się odpowiednia aktualizacja od Microsoft, musimy cierpieć w ten sposób.
Czas instalacji / naprawy / odinstalowania zależy od specyfikacji maszyny tylko wtedy, gdy idzie gładko (w idealnym przypadku). W przypadku konfliktu niektórych ustawień konfiguracja po prostu utknęła na początkowych etapach przez godzinę.
To anulowane wylogowanie, jak sugeruje @Joe, rzeczywiście przesunęło pasek postępu, ale muszę to powtórzyć kilkanaście razy. Wciąż nie znaleziono lepszego rozwiązania. Ponadto, po przejściu wszystkich elementów, w ostatnim kroku domu trzymam go ponownie przez całą noc. Anulowane Wylogowanie przestało być skuteczne. W końcu muszę wymusić zamknięcie konfiguracji. ALE cała ta cierpliwość zapłacona w końcu, Visual Studio uruchomiło się poprawnie bez ostrzeżenia o niekompletnej instalacji.
PS: w czasie pisania Microsoft FixIt , który ma naprawić zablokowaną instalację / odinstalowanie, nie obsługuje systemu Windows 10 (zobacz zrzut ekranu poniżej)
PPS: Niektórzy użytkownicy sugerowali wyłączenie programu antywirusowego / antymalware w takich sytuacjach. Możesz spróbować na własne ryzyko.
źródło
Wygląda na to, że coś rzeczywiście blokuje proces naprawy, a także proces odinstalowywania. Ponieważ studio wizualne jest dość duże (jeśli wybierzesz wszystko do zainstalowania, jest rzeczywiście bardzo duże), samo naprawienie zajmie trochę czasu, w zależności od tego, co jest zainstalowane i co jest z nim nie tak.
Moje pierwsze myśli o tym, dlaczego wisi, może wynikać z tego, że dysk twardy wyłącza się z braku aktywności, część sposobu oszczędzania energii w systemie Windows, szczególnie na laptopach, może być również dlatego, że idzie spać, z których oba są powoduje problemy z programami, które zajmują trochę czasu. Możesz więc spróbować przejść do opcji zasilania, a następnie do zaawansowanych opcji zasilania i albo ustawić, aby wyłączyć dysk twardy, aby był dłuższy, lub ustawić go tak, aby nigdy nie był taki sam ze snem.
Jeśli masz programy antywirusowe i / lub antywirusowe, jest całkiem prawdopodobne, że wpływają one na proces naprawy / odinstalowania, ponieważ najprawdopodobniej powodują blokadę odczytu / zapisu w plikach, które program Visual Studio próbuje zmodyfikować lub naprawa itp. Niektóre programy antywirusowe i anty-malware skanują pliki podczas ich tworzenia lub zapisywania, co powoduje problemy z niektórymi programami. Spróbuj wyłączyć je podczas naprawy studia wizualnego.
Jeśli nadal nie możesz nic zrobić, alternatywą byłoby wymuszone usunięcie programu Visual Studio poprzez usunięcie folderu, w którym jest on zainstalowany, zwykle w plikach programu lub plikach programu x86, a następnie przejdź do panelu sterowania kliknij przycisk odinstaluj i powinien powiedzieć jest już odinstalowany lub wyświetla komunikat o błędzie, który chcesz usunąć z listy programów, kliknij przycisk tak. Następnie, po ponownym uruchomieniu, powinieneś móc ponownie zainstalować program Visual Studio. Nie jest to najbardziej idealny sposób na ponowną instalację programu, ale działa on przez większość czasu.
Inną alternatywą do wypróbowania byłoby uruchomienie programu Microsoft FixIt i sprawdzenie, czy to również rozwiąże jakiekolwiek problemy.
źródło
Miałem ten sam problem. Po zablokowaniu działania antywirusa szybkość odinstalowywania wzrosła około 100-1000 razy. Tak, nadal jest wolny, ale widzę, że pasek postępu się porusza.
źródło
Właśnie anulowałem „wylogowanie” na moim komputerze z systemem Windows 10, a pasek postępu odinstalowywania przeskoczył CAŁĄ WIĄZKĘ.
:) BLEEPING komputerów! :)
źródło